1. Cacti become dried mainly due to lack of light

Most flower friends who want to grow very thick cacti should pay attention to many issues. The first thing to note is the issue of lighting. Many flower friends' cacti do not grow well, and the first thing to consider is whether they lack sunlight.

Cacti are flowers that love sunlight and are best kept on a sunny south-facing balcony or outdoors. The stronger the sunlight, the better the cacti grow. Once they lack sunlight, the leaves of the cacti start to shrivel, affecting their ornamental value.

2. Cacti may lack spirit due to insufficient water

Usually when we talk about cacti, many flower friends automatically associate them with drought resistance. Because cacti are native to desert areas, they indeed have good drought resistance. However, good drought resistance does not mean they do not need water. If you find that the fleshy stems of the cacti have started to shrink and look dried, it is likely they are short of water.

Watering cacti should be done when the soil is dry. You must water them only when the soil is completely dry, because even if the surface is dry, the bottom may still be moist due to the strong root system of cacti. Water thoroughly but do not let water accumulate, as excessive watering can easily lead to root rot in cacti.
